A bike bag brand that caters to the growing and underserved micromobility population, Po Campo launched its sustainable, reflective City Lights Collection.

Micromobility is defined as people using bikes and/or scooters for short trips under five miles. Designed with this micromobility commuter in mind, its City Lights 4-bag collection is made from Po Campo’s proprietary, sustainable and reflective Visi-Hemp fabric and delivers convenience, style and heightened visibility.

With a dedication to sustainability, Po Campo has developed a reflective hemp fabric, Visi-Hemp. A blend of 55 percent hemp and 45 percent recycled polyester, Visi-Hemp has highly reflective fibers woven within, is soft to the touch and durable. The reflective thread is woven in a pattern that mimics the appearance of a city skyline at night and is visible both day and night, allowing the wearer to feel safer when commuting.

Available in August 2021, Po Campo’s City Lights collection incorporates strategically placed pockets that are easy to access, and front pocket flaps with Fidlock magnetic snaps to keep belongings secure and protected from the elements. The collection includes the Ara Backpack, Vega Sling, Aster Hip Pack, Beta Mini Sling.
